About the role

Join our dynamic team as a (Sr.) Engineer, where you'll play a critical role in advancing interconnection projects within the PJM queue process. This position is your chance to be at the forefront of innovation, working on high-impact projects that support energy reliability and sustainability.

Responsibilities

  • Lead interconnection analyses to support and guide development projects through the PJM queue process.
  • Evaluate customer requests to ensure compliance with NERC standards, FERC directives as well as PJM and transmission owner planning principles.
  • Conduct key studies, including load generator deliverability, generation retirement, and system reliability assessments.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ders, manage consultant activities, and oversee technical evaluations such as load flow, short circuit, and dynamic stability studies.

Essential Functions

  • Conduct comprehensive power system analyses to support reports for interconnection requests, retirement studies, and related projects.
  • Identify and assess transmission system upgrades necessary to address reliability and operational challenges.
  • Perform system adequacy and reliability evaluations to ensure optimal performance of the PJM grid.
  • Drive innovation by contributing to the development of new methods and practices in the planning process.
  • Prepare detailed reports and engaging presentations to support the initiatives of the System Planning Division.
  • Provide actionable recommendations to PJM management regarding the implementation of new bulk power facilities, programs, procedures, and policies.
  • Develop and maintain accurate transmission system models essential for generating reports on interconnection requests, system retirements, and other planning activities.
  • Collaborate with transmission owners to refine and develop reinforcements identified through various analyses.
  • Partner with colleagues within the System Planning Division to tackle complex engineering challenges.
  • Represent PJM on industry committees, task forces, and stakeholder groups addressing planning and engineering topics.
